Abstract
BACKGROUND: Obstetric fistula is among the most devastating maternal morbidities that occur as a result of prolonged, obstructed labor. Usually, the child dies in a large number of the cases. Moreover, some of the women become infertile while the majority suffer physical, psychosocial and economic challenges. Approximately 5000 new cases of obstetric fistula occur in Sudan each year. However, their experiences are under documented. Therefore, this study aimed to shed light on their daily lives living with obstetric fistula and how they cope.Entities:

Characteristics of women
| Pseudonym | Age | Educational Level | Marital Status | Years (y) /Months (m) with OF | Number of Surgeries |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Sakeena | 24 | Illiterate | Divorced | 4 y | 2 |
| Aisha | 16 | Primary school | Married | 5 m | 0 |
| Haleema | 32 | Illiterate | Divorced | 4 y | 0 |
| Fatima | 30 | Illiterate | Abandoned | 7 y | 0 |
| Marwa | 20 | Illiterate | Divorced | 10 m | 0 |
| Altaya | 17 | Primary school | Married | 8 m | 0 |
| Sara | 20 | Illiterate | abandoned | 1 y | 0 |
| Mona | 18 | Illiterate | Married | 1 y | 1 |
| Samia | 58 | Teachers Institute | Widow | 18 y | 1 |
| Sit Albanat | 45 | Illiterate | Married | 15 y | 2 |
| Maha | 18 | Illiterate | Abandoned | 1.5 y | 2 |
| Zeinat | 27 | University – 1st year | Married | 6 y | 6 |
| Asma | 47 | Primary school | Married | 7 y | 2 |
| Sitana | 50 | Illiterate | Widow | 15 y | 1 |
| Amira | 27 | Illiterate | Divorced | 12 y | 3 |
| Khadeeja | 33 | Midwifery school | Married | 5 y | 1 |
| Maysa | 23 | Primary school | Divorced | 7 y | 1 |
| Ensaf | 33 | Illiterate | Divorced | 17 y | 11 |
| Tahani | 30 | University | Married | 2 y | 1 |
